Types of Parrots Available in Berlin
Before buying, it's vital to determine which type of parrot is the very best suitable for your lifestyle. Below is a choice of popular parrot types commonly found in Berlin, including their average sizes and characters.
| Parrot Species | Average Size | Personality |
|---|---|---|
| Budgerigar (Budgie) | 7 inches | Friendly, friendly |
| Cockatiel | 12-14 inches | Caring, lively |
| African Grey | 12-14 inches | Smart, social |
| Amazon Parrot | 10-15 inches | Playful, vocal |
| Macaw | 24-40 inches | Caring, social |

Where to Buy a Parrot in Berlin
Getting a parrot involves choosing a trustworthy source. Below is a table detailing various choices readily available in Berlin:
| Source |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pet Stores | Commercial stores with a range of animals readily available | Immediate availability | Greater rates |
| Bird Sanctuaries | Saved and rehabilitated birds for adoption | Support for animal welfare | Minimal types availability |
| Private Breeders | People specializing in breeding specific types | Healthy, well-cared for birds | Danger of bad breeding practices |
| Online Marketplaces | Sites for purchasing and offering birds | Wide choice | Risk of rip-offs |

Expenses Associated with Purchasing a Parrot
Purchasing a parrot is just the beginning; potential owners must also think about the continuous expenses of care. Below is a breakdown of estimated expenses related to owning a parrot in Berlin.
| Expense Item | Approximated Cost (EUR) |
|---|---|
| Initial Purchase | 50-- 3,000+ |
| Cage | 100-- 500 |
| Food (month-to-month) | 30-- 100 |
| Veterinary Care (yearly) | 50-- 200 |
| Toys & & Accessories (month-to-month) | 15-- 50 |
| Insurance (monthly) | 10-- 30 |

Frequently asked questions About Buying a Parrot in Berlin
1. Are there any legal restrictions on owning a parrot in Berlin?
Yes, certain species may be subject to regulations under the Federal Nature Conservation Act. It's vital to validate if the types you are interested in is allowed.
2. Can I train my parrot to talk?
Yes, lots of parrots can imitating human speech. Training needs persistence and consistency, and some species, like African Greys, are known for their exceptional vocal abilities.
3. Just how much time do I require to dedicate to my parrot each day?
Parrots are social animals that need everyday interaction. Go for at least 2-4 hours of direct interaction, plus time for independent play.
4. What is the average life expectancy of animal parrots?
Life expectancy varies by species, but many parrots can live anywhere from 15 to 50 years, depending on their care and environment.
5. Do parrots need unique diet plans?
Yes, parrots gain from a different diet plan that consists of pellets, fresh fruits, and veggies, in addition to periodic seeds. Speak with a veterinarian or bird professional for dietary assistance.
